Verify before you book

  • That a specific purifier model performs as marketed — ask for the filtration rating and independent (e.g. AHAM/UL 2998) validation.
  • Whether your ductwork can handle a higher-restriction filter — ask for a static-pressure check.

What kind of whole-house air purifier actually works?
Proven filtration does the work: a MERV 13+ media cabinet for most homes, or a true HEPA-bypass system for allergy/asthma households. Match it to your system's airflow so the filter doesn't starve the blower. Be skeptical of ionizers or 'air sanitizers' sold instead of filtration — the EPA calls them emerging, with limited independent evidence; ask for UL 2998 zero-ozone proof.
Is a whole-house purifier better than portable units?
A whole-house cleaner treats every room the HVAC serves and runs quietly in the ductwork, while portables only cover the room they're in. Portables are a fine, cheaper fix for one bedroom; a ducted system makes sense when the whole home needs it or someone has asthma or strong allergies.
How do I vet companies for whole-house air purifier or media-filter upgrades in Olive Branch?
Look for providers who list specific purifier models and filtration MERV ratings and who can demonstrate installation experience on similar homes. Ask for before-and-after particulate testing, references for recent installs in Olive Branch, and whether the installer offers a warranty or maintenance plan for the filter media.
What IAQ tests should technicians perform during an Olive Branch inspection?
Common tests include humidity readings, particle counts, and visual mold inspection. Technicians should also check filter condition and airflow. Ask which tests the company includes in the initial estimate, whether they supply a written results report, and if follow-up testing is offered after mitigation.
